What is the Marfan Syndrome?
Marfan
syndrome is a rare hereditary disorder of the connective tissue
which effects many parts of the body such as the heart, the blood
vessels, the eyes, the bones, and the lungs.
Marfan
syndrome affects men, women and children of all races. It is estimated
that only in the United States 200.000 people have this disorder.
